4,294,988,000 is a composite number, even.
4,294,988,000 (four billion two hundred ninety-four million nine hundred eighty-eight thousand) is an even 10-digit number. It is a composite number with 192 divisors, and factors as 2⁵ × 5³ × 19 × 31 × 1,823. Its proper divisors sum to 7,177,826,080,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1000050E0.
